Maritime Exhibits and Activites in Marblehead

-

View the classic boats gathered for the Corinthian Classic Yacht Regatta and explore maritime exhibits, activities and vendors, including everything from boat builders to artists. Exhibits and activities will be located at the State Street Landing, and Little Harbor and Fort Sewall areas. Harbor tours, paddle boarding, kayaking, and many family activities are ongoing all weekend. Picnic at Fort Sewall Sun., Aug. 12, while the classic yachts under sail return to the harbor from their final competition.


Marblehead, Massachusetts: State Street Landing, and Little Harbor and Fort Sewall areas
